//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
// closure capture analysis
|
||||
//
|
||||
// A closure (anonymous `fn`) may reference the enclosing function's locals.
|
||||
// Since the VM compiles each function with its own frame, those references
|
||||
// are resolved by capturing the values at closure-creation time: the compiler
|
||||
// scans the body for free variables, registers them as the lambda's leading
|
||||
// local slots, and emits loads of their current values before op_closure.
|
||||
|
||||
// scan_captures returns the enclosing locals a closure body references, in
|
||||
// first-reference order (stable and deterministic for codegen).
